Dimensionally, as mentioned, the Explorer II measures in at 42mm across, which for some is simply too big. But, because the case is relatively slim at 12mm thick, it does wear smaller than you may think. There are differences, they're just subtle. The previous 42mm version was already a wide, and relatively thin, wristwatch, and that continues with the 226570, which is a hair thinner at 12.5mm than the ref 1655, the Explorer II that started it all.

Signaling a major turning point for the collection, the then-new ref. 216570 was larger than any other Explorer II watch at 42mm in diameter. Additionally, while the lug width on all previous Explorer II watches was 20mm, the updated Rolex 216570 featured slightly larger 21mm lugs to better match its larger case.

The Explorer II ref. 16570 was, in fact, the last 40mm Explorer II reference – the others that have followed have all sported larger 42mm cases, dials with more exaggerated details, and broader numerals on the engraved bezel.Launched in 1971, the Explorer II is the worthy heir to the Explorer and shares its same qualities of resistance to extreme conditions.
